EOU Men’s Hoops Cruises to 22-Point Victory at New Hope Christian
EUGENE, Ore. – The EOU men’s basketball team (7-0) were led by sophomore Max McCullough and freshman Jordan May who scored 19 points apiece to lead the Blue and Gold to its first official road victory Friday night.
Senior guard Brennan Pope recorded his first double-double of the season dropping 12 points and 11 rebounds. Senior guard/forward Blake O’Donnell scored 14 points to go along with eight boards.
New Hope Christian was led by Jaylen Rose with 17 points, DeMario Harris added 16 points and Isiah Large chipped in 13 points and dished out six assists.
After nearly 10 minutes of play in the first half, EOU found itself leading by three, 11-8, after a bucket from junior forward Peter Eke. The scoreboard was kept tight as the Mounties built a lead as large as eight, before the Deacons stormed back with a 9-2 spurt with just over two minutes in the first stanza to close the half only trailing by one, 29-28.
Midway through the second half senior forward Austin Winegar’s jumper gave EOU a 15-point lead, 60-45, as the Mountaineers made 70 percent (23-for-34) of their shots from the field in the second half. They matched that going 5-for-10 from beyond the arc, building an advantage as large as 24, to seal the road triumph.
